Output ec9c39df88bdb03b53443f52e289bd62a1ce26b6b6070a47b24ec53be7a13e59:1

value
57169578
script pubkey
OP_0 OP_PUSHBYTES_20 2c6b150de97eb0ca87e1f2bc57bc17a831e2583b
address
bc1q93432r0f06cv4plp727900qh4qc7ykpmpjqnee
transaction
ec9c39df88bdb03b53443f52e289bd62a1ce26b6b6070a47b24ec53be7a13e59